The textbook βOperaciones De Separaci N Por Etapas De Equilibrio En Ing Qu Micaβ by Henley and Seader is a widely used reference in chemical engineering education. The book provides a comprehensive treatment of separation processes, including the principles of mass transfer, thermodynamics, and fluid mechanics. The textbook covers various separation processes, including distillation, absorption, extraction, and adsorption, and provides numerous examples and problems to illustrate the application of these principles.
